In dream towns, nothing saves. You can take everything but it will still stay the same.
Also, all shops and buildings, like The Roost or Town Hall, will always be closed in dreams.

COLOURS: I loved the colour of the tilling and how it ties in so well with the perfect peaches, gold roses and the white of the Jacob’s ladders. I also like the way you have mixed the different flower colours – beautiful.

TOWN LAYOUT, bridges and PWP placements: Wow, one of the best I have come across. There is no abruptness. One thing leads to another. So much thought and planning must have gone into this. I loved, loved, loved the way you placed the topiaries leading off the plaza (my fav area) towards the bridge and across the bridge arriving to a couple of gold roses which nicely tie the Fairy Bridge to the fairy bench and fairy lights together. I get a very fairy tale theme without the pink and frills - just elegance.

I like the bushes surrounding the drinking fountain. Nice touch. I also like how you embrace the permanent stones and not try to disguise them. Stones are usually a pain to most of us (me included) but you have turned them into a feature in their own right.

Suggestions from an impressed visitor’s perspective:

I only had two suggestions and you might have already thought about them but they might be impossible to achieve because of space or number of allowed PWPs.

The water fountain would look better directly aligned with the outdoor chair. I sat in the chair and could see the fountain to the side and it did not tally with the way you have placed other features. It appeared out of line. I am not sure if there is enough space to accommodate it directly behind the outdoor chair. There would be two spaces between the river edge and fountain.
The second suggestion is perhaps placing a small PWP in front of Patrice’s house where the 4 pink Carnations are. That area appeared to be missing something. Something like an illuminated tree might suit that area. I noticed one when you walk slight north-east from the four Carnations.
